Menthol has the chemical formula C10H20O. This is read as "C sub 10, H sub 20, O," or colloquially as "C-10, H-20, O," and means that each menthol compound is comprised of 10 carbon atoms, 20 hydrogen atoms, and a single oxygen atom.
Molecular mass is the measurement of how much something weighs per unit. Menthol has a molecular mass of 156.27 grams per mol. This number is calculated by summing up all of the individual weights of each atom that makes up menthol.

The melting point of a substance refers to the temperature at which that substance will change from a solid state to a liquid state. Menthol has a melting point of 35 to 45 degrees Celsius, or 95 to 113 degrees Fahrenheit--a wide range covering eight different types of menthol.
The boiling point refers to the temperature at which a substance will change from a liquid state to a gas state. Menthol has a boiling point of 212 degrees Celsius, or 413.6 degrees Fahrenheit, regardless of which type of menthol is present.
